The History Behind the Forbidden City

Constructed in the early 15th century during the Ming Dynasty, the Forbidden City served as the imperial palace for emperors of China for over 500 years. It was a symbolic center of power and the residence for 24 emperors from the Ming and Qing dynasties. Today, it stands as a testament to China’s cultural heritage.

The Architectural Marvels of the Forbidden City

The Forbidden City spans an impressive 180 acres and consists of more than 900 buildings, making it the world’s largest palace complex. Its architectural design embodies the principles of Feng Shui and reflects the harmony between humans and nature. The palaces, halls, gardens, and moats all combine to create a magnificent sight that leaves visitors in awe.

2. How long does it take to explore the Forbidden City?

The Forbidden City is vast, and exploring every corner can take several hours. On average, visitors spend around 2-3 hours exploring the main highlights. However, if you are interested in delving deeper into the history and details, you might want to allocate a full day to fully appreciate its grandeur.

3. What are some must-see attractions within the Forbidden City?

Some of the must-see attractions within the Forbidden City include the Hall of Supreme Harmony, the Hall of Preserving Harmony, the Palace of Heavenly Purity, and the Imperial Garden. These locations showcase the exquisite architecture, intricate decorations, and historical significance of the imperial palace.

4. Are there any restrictions when visiting the Forbidden City?

Yes, there are a few restrictions to keep in mind when visiting the Forbidden City. Smoking, eating, and drinking are not allowed within the complex. Additionally, certain areas might be temporarily closed for preservation purposes. It’s important to respect the rules and regulations to ensure the preservation of this cultural treasure.
